
Medical Examiner Confirms Youtuber Mikayla Raines's Cause of Death — Details
The wildlife rehabilitator’s autopsy results were released just weeks after her husband tearfully announced her devastating death in a social media video.
The Midwest Medical Examiner's Office reportedly confirmed that 29-year-old YouTube star and animal activist, Mikayla Raines, died by suicide.
Mikayla is said to have taken her own life by hanging herself in a barn at her home in Faribault, Minnesota. Her body was found on June 20, 2025.
Days later, the influencer's husband, Ethan Raines, tearfully announced her death by suicide on June 23 in an emotional video on social media. He expressed that this was the most "hurtful" and "difficult" time in his life as he read through a note he had written about his wife.
Ethan said the fox rescue activist, who devoted her love to animals, also managed to love him. Their bond together was unlike anything he had experienced before. That said, half of him is missing.
"I feel broken. But I will continue her dream, and I hope to have your support going forward so that we can do good in her name," Ethan, who noted that he gave Mikayla all of his love and energy, captioned the Instagram post.
